diff options
author | 2024-12-13 16:13:43 -0800 | |
---|---|---|
committer | 2024-12-13 16:13:43 -0800 | |
commit | 322c4382951618e134e961507f07a68c99428f17 (patch) | |
tree | 6dd46e1b36836be8af923f44386bf84da3920f79 /filesystem/filesystem.go | |
parent | 71340584f8d48d10578731c0b2dadfd178055ad6 (diff) | |
parent | fee270187d49304460e1db46c0a29fd0e97a832c (diff) |
Merge "Make BuildLinkerConfig run in its own action" into main
Diffstat (limited to 'filesystem/filesystem.go')
-rw-r--r-- | filesystem/filesystem.go |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/filesystem/filesystem.go b/filesystem/filesystem.go index bff0a1014..eb39a78c6 100644 --- a/filesystem/filesystem.go +++ b/filesystem/filesystem.go @@ -886,8 +886,10 @@ func (f *filesystem) BuildLinkerConfigFile(ctx android.ModuleContext, builder *a } provideModules, _ := f.getLibsForLinkerConfig(ctx) + intermediateOutput := android.PathForModuleOut(ctx, "linker.config.pb") + linkerconfig.BuildLinkerConfig(ctx, android.PathsForModuleSrc(ctx, f.properties.Linker_config.Linker_config_srcs), provideModules, nil, intermediateOutput) output := rebasedDir.Join(ctx, "etc", "linker.config.pb") - linkerconfig.BuildLinkerConfig(ctx, builder, android.PathsForModuleSrc(ctx, f.properties.Linker_config.Linker_config_srcs), provideModules, nil, output) + builder.Command().Text("cp").Input(intermediateOutput).Output(output) f.appendToEntry(ctx, output) } |